Baked Feta with Rainbow Vegetable Crudités
Preparation time is 15minutes
Cook time is 15minutes
Total time is 30minutes
Serve is for 6 people

9 Ingredients
Number of servings
6
- 400grams feta
- 1tablespoons olive oil, divided
- 2teaspoons honey
- 2teaspoons thyme, fresh
- 2 medium carrots, peeled, chopped into batons
- 1 medium cucumber, chopped into batons
- 100grams radishes, halved
- 200grams cherry tomatoes, halved
- 4 sticks celery, cut into batons

Description
Baking feta transforms it into a creamy dip, perfect with a little honey and thyme.
Instruction tip
Serve any raw vegetable you like with this and add some baguette slices on the side.
Method
Step 1 of 3
Pre-heat the oven to 180°C/160°C fan-forced and place the feta blocks in a small, oven proof serving dish.
Step 2 of 3
Drizzle the olive oil and honey over the feta and top with thyme leaves.
Step 3 of 3
Bake the feta for 8-10 minutes, remove from the oven and serve with the crudites arranged around the serving dish.
